Ice rinks
Ice Hockey – The Czech national team have won the championship eleven times, most recently in 2005. They also took Olympic Gold in 1998.
Prague’s two main teams are HC Slavia Praha and HC Sparta Praha. O2 Arena is the home rink for Slavia Praha and also hosts other major events because of its large capacity. The Tesla Arena is Sparta Praha’s home rink and it is considerably smaller.
